Description

Left brain meets right when your students use role-playing to illustrate science and math principles. This wonderful tool allows you to use your own creativity and knowledge of your class to adapt themes and activities. Reader's Theatre enforces national standards and works for students of all reading abilities. Grades 5-7.

Author Biography:

Chris Gustafson is a teacher librarian from Whitman Middle School in Seattle, WA. Her published works include the Acting Cool! titles.
